gpt4 book ai didi

html - 什么是用于重组文本的简单网页编译器?

转载 作者:搜寻专家 更新时间:2023-10-31 08:05:16 24 4
gpt4 key购买 nike

我想要一个基于 html 的静态站点,而不是博客/cms,其中包含几个(很少更新的)页面。我认为更新它们的最简单方法是将源代码保存为类似 ReST 的格式,并在每次更新时对其进行编译。这种用法推荐的编译器是什么?我想要自己的主题/设计,除了正确的 ReST 语法外我不需要任何东西(例如,Sphinx 太多了)。

最佳答案

Makefile 是一个很好的解决方案。这是一个快速模板 makefile

# Flags to pass to rst2html
# e.g. RSTFLAGS = --stylesheet-path=mystyle.css
RSTFLAGS =

%.html: %.rst
rst2html $(RSTFLAGS) $< $@

.PHONY: all
.DEFAULT: all

all: index.html foo.html bar.html # any other html files to be generated from an rst file

然后只需在包含您的文件的目录中运行 make 即可从第一个文件生成 html

关于html - 什么是用于重组文本的简单网页编译器?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/2096558/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com